Hi Andrea,

I added your patch to test1-2.2.0-pre2, and your patch does not appear
to work, becuase the page cache grows too large and swaps out too many
things.

At bootup:
telomere:~> cat free1
total used free shared buffers
cached
Mem: 63476 25684 37792 18108 1476
15376
-/+ buffers/cache: 8832 54644
Swap: 34236 0 34236

After running netscape:
telomere:~> cat free2
total used free shared buffers
cached
Mem: 63476 48352 15124 30592 1796
28772
-/+ buffers/cache: 17784 45692
Swap: 34236 0 34236

After running 'wc /usr/bin/*'
telomere:~> cat free3
total used free shared buffers
cached
Mem: 63476 61100 2376 10464 1064
51040
-/+ buffers/cache: 8996 54480
Swap: 34236 9904 24332

Without your patch, running 'wc /usr/bin/*' swaps out only about 220k.
So perhaps your change to 'count' in filemap.c was incorrect?

> - count = (limit<<1) >> (priority);
> + count = limit >> priority;
